diff --git a/source/org/jivesoftware/smackx/provider/DataFormProvider.java b/source/org/jivesoftware/smackx/provider/DataFormProvider.java index 278253a1d..c122d461b 100644 --- a/source/org/jivesoftware/smackx/provider/DataFormProvider.java +++ b/source/org/jivesoftware/smackx/provider/DataFormProvider.java @@ -108,9 +108,8 @@ public class DataFormProvider implements PacketExtensionProvider { private FormField parseField(XmlPullParser parser) throws Exception { boolean done = false; - FormField formField = new FormField(); + FormField formField = new FormField(parser.getAttributeValue("", "var")); formField.setLabel(parser.getAttributeValue("", "label")); - formField.setVariable(parser.getAttributeValue("", "var")); formField.setType(parser.getAttributeValue("", "type")); while (!done) { int eventType = parser.next();